In
Unbeatable Chess Lessons, chess coach Robert Snyder takes his
Chess for Everyone book a step further by covering twenty-four games with commentary on every move in each game.
- Games arranged by opening to help students improve their knowledge of important openings.
- Games and analysis contain important tactical and positional themes to improve pattern recognition and planning ability.
- Games played by the author and world famous players such as Fischer, Spassky, Alekhine and Capablanca.
- Challenges at various points to find the best move.
- Written for the beginner to intermediate player.
